Samuel M.
"Sam" Kraeer Jr.
Dec 5, 1945 — May 2, 2021
Samuel M. "Sam" Kraeer, Jr., 75 of Washington, PA died unexpectedly Sunday May 2, 2021.
He was born December 5, 1945 in Washington, PA a son of the late Samuel M. and Hilda L. Seal Kraeer Sr.
Mr. Kraeer was 1963 graduate of Trinity High School and a proud veteran of the U.S. Army where he served as an E-5 and pharmacy specialist in the 544 th Medical Dispensary in Korea during the Vietnam War Era. For his service he was awarded the expert rifleman badge, Good Conduct Medal, and the National Defense Service Medal.
He was a self-employed farmer operating the Kraeer Farm and Dairy in Washington from 1962 until present and was a member of the Farm Bureau of Washington.
Mr. Kraeer enjoyed hunting, fishing, tractor pulling, his family and any child that he encountered. Always referring to him as, "Pappy Sam", he always made sure he had candy to share.
Sam left us to be with the Lord on a beautiful Sunday afternoon on his farm with his boots on doing what he loved and what he dedicated his life to. The only thing that may have been stronger than his love for farming and his family quite possibly could have been his work ethic and his word.
